The latest update is out from Shutterstock ( (SSTK) ).
On July 12, 2026, Shutterstock’s longtime Chief Executive Officer and board member Paul J. Hennessy stepped down, with Chief Financial Officer Rik Powell appointed as Interim CEO while retaining his CFO role, and Hennessy staying on as an adviser through August 7, 2026. The board, emphasizing leadership evolution amid wider technology-sector shifts, enhanced Powell’s compensation for his expanded responsibilities and plans to hire a strategic advisor to help shape Shutterstock’s strategy following the termination of its merger agreement with Getty Images and the launch of a search for a permanent chief executive.

Spark’s Take on SSTK Stock
According to Spark, TipRanks’ AI Analyst, SSTK is a Neutral.
The score is held back primarily by weak technicals (price far below key moving averages with negative momentum) and a softened financial profile (TTM revenue decline, margin compression, and net losses). Positive free cash flow and a very high dividend yield provide support, but corporate developments (merger termination and FTC settlement) add incremental risk.

More about Shutterstock
Shutterstock, Inc. is a New York–based provider of creative and generative AI solutions, offering businesses, creatives and brand leaders access to one of the world’s largest collections of high-quality licensable visual assets, specialized training datasets and evaluation tools. The company also delivers advertising and distribution solutions, exclusive editorial content and full-service studio production, positioning itself as an end-to-end strategic partner for the model training lifecycle and content-driven marketing.
